A radiation therapist is one of the best-paying medical jobs with little schooling. Entry-level radiation therapists earn an average of $60,080 each year. With as few as one to four years of experience, salaries can increase by more than $11,000. Radiation therapists with ten to nineteen years of experience can earn up to $107,830 annually. 9. Nurse anesthetist. Median pay: $195,610. If you’re interested in becoming a nurse, and you like the idea of mastering very focused and specific duties, this could be the job for you. Nurse anesthetists administer local or general anesthesia to patients to eliminate any pain during medical procedures.

Medical director. National average salary: £103,637 per year Primary duties: Medical directors are senior doctors who have managerial responsibilities within hospitals and health trusts.Neurologist. Salary range: $320,500-$400,000 per year. A neurologist is a doctor who specializes in the care of the central and peripheral nervous systems. Neurologists assist patients with neurological examinations, diagnostics, treatment and referrals and may work in hospitals, clinics, or private practices.
